theme park
an amusement park whose décor, rides, etc. are designed to reflect a central theme, such as a particular period in history or the world of the future countable noun: A theme park is a large outdoor area where people pay to go to enjoy themselves. All the different activities in a theme park are usually based on a particular idea or theme. noun: an amusement park in which landscaping, buildings, and attractions are based on one or more specific themes, as jungle wildlife, fairy tales, or the Old West noun: an area planned as a leisure attraction, in which all the displays, buildings, activities, etc, are based on or relate to one particular subject |
